Output e8ad031b5f23a40a8a44c98051b2b4b7cb3c47851fc30fff2777b2ac089ffcdb:1

value
1344007
script pubkey
OP_0 OP_PUSHBYTES_20 505644f805a082b60ed0217e1c3e306a227b094e
address
bc1q2ptyf7q95zptvrksy9lpc03sdg38kz2wtm0l9g
transaction
e8ad031b5f23a40a8a44c98051b2b4b7cb3c47851fc30fff2777b2ac089ffcdb
confirmations
140571
spent
true